Robert Helewka 9dc766d631 fix(lab): silence Asterisk noise at the source, keep notice logging
Follow-up to 3150f78, which over-corrected. Dropping `notice` from logger.conf
made the log quiet by making the gateway undebuggable: Asterisk reports
rejected SIP requests at notice level via log_failed_request ("No matching
endpoint found", "Failed to authenticate"), and on a box whose entire job is
answering SIP those are the most useful lines it produces. A call was refused
and nothing said so.

`notice` is restored. The noise is dealt with where it originates instead:

- modules.conf, new. The image ships `autoload=yes` and loads every module it
  was built with, including chan_alsa on a container with no sound card:
  ~74 ALSA config errors per restart, plus module-load ERRORs for CDR/CEL
  backends, LDAP/ODBC realtime config, and format_ogg_vorbis — none of which
  can work here. Explicit noload for those; autoload stays on, because an
  allow-list would break quietly the first time a scenario needs a module
  nobody remembered to add.

- The healthcheck reduction from 3150f78 (one CLI connection on a 60s
  interval, rather than the image's ~7 every 30s) does the rest.

Verified on galatea: ALSA lines 74 → 0, all startup ERRORs gone (only one-off
benign WARNINGs remain), steady-state 4 lines per 2 minutes against ~840 per
30 minutes originally — and a refused call still logs 6 diagnostic lines.
Transport bound, both endpoints and dialplan loaded, container healthy.

`verbose` stays excluded: dialplan execution is worth having when tracing a
specific call, not worth shipping to Loki continuously. Raise it at runtime
with `asterisk -rx "core set verbose 3"`.

; Module loading for the lab.
;
; The image ships `autoload=yes`, which loads every module Asterisk was built
; with. On a headless container that produces a lot of startup noise for
; hardware and backends that do not exist here — measured at ~74 ALSA lines
; plus a dozen module-load ERRORs per restart, all of it in Loki. None of it
; was harmful; all of it made the log harder to read.
;
; autoload stays on: this is a lab, and an explicit allow-list would break
; quietly every time a scenario needs a module nobody remembered to add. The
; noload lines below are only for modules that *cannot* work in this container.
[modules]
autoload=yes
; --- Audio hardware -------------------------------------------------------
; No sound card in a container. chan_alsa/chan_oss probe for one and emit
; ~74 lines of ALSA config errors on every start. The media path is RTP via
; PJSIP, never a local device.
noload => chan_alsa.so
noload => chan_oss.so
noload => chan_console.so
; --- CDR/CEL backends for databases we do not run -------------------------
; Each logs "declined to load" or a config error at startup. Call records live
; in Hold Slayer's own Postgres, written by the gateway, not by Asterisk.
noload => cdr_pgsql.so
noload => cdr_sqlite3_custom.so
noload => cdr_custom.so
noload => cdr_csv.so
noload => cel_pgsql.so
noload => cel_sqlite3_custom.so
noload => cel_custom.so
; --- Realtime config backends we do not use -------------------------------
; The lab's configuration is the mounted .conf files. LDAP/ODBC/PgSQL realtime
; each complain about missing connection details on every start.
noload => res_config_ldap.so
noload => res_config_odbc.so
noload => res_config_pgsql.so
noload => res_config_sqlite3.so
; --- Codecs and formats that fail to initialise ----------------------------
; format_ogg_vorbis errors on load. The lab plays .sln (signed linear) and
; negotiates ulaw/alaw, so nothing here needs Vorbis.
noload => format_ogg_vorbis.so
noload => format_ogg_speex.so
